What causes Skin conditions?
Article excerpts about the
causes of Skin conditions:
Sunlight is a major cause of the skin changes we think of as
aging — changes such as wrinkles, dryness, and age spots. Your skin
does change with age. For example, you sweat less, leading to
increased dryness. As your skin ages, it becomes thinner and loses
fat, so it looks less plump and smooth. Underlying structures —
veins and bones in particular — become more prominent. Your skin can
take longer to heal when injured. (Source: excerpt from Skin Care and Aging -- Age Page -- Health Information: NIA)
